Conviction and Sentencing in Marten-Gordon Infant Manslaughter Case

A court has sentenced Constance Marten, 38, and Mark Gordon, 51, to 14 years in prison each following their conviction for the gross negligence manslaughter of their newborn daughter. The couple received their sentences on Monday after being found guilty in a lengthy retrial at the Old Bailey in July.

Authorities discovered the decomposed body of their baby, Victoria, in a shopping bag in Brighton in 2023. This discovery followed a 53-day search for Marten and Gordon, initiated after officers found evidence of a recent birth in a burnt-out vehicle near Bolton. Presiding over the sentencing, Judge Mark Lucraft KC commented that neither defendant demonstrated significant consideration for their baby’s welfare or expressed genuine remorse.
